Alfred Reynolds (Composer)
Born: 15th August 1884, Liverpool, UK
Died: 18th October 1969, Bognor Regis, UK
Nationality: English
Alfred Reynolds was a composer of light music for the theatre.
He was born in Liverpool and educated at Merchant Taylors' School and later in France. He studied with Engelbert Humperdinck in Berlin.
In 1910, he conducted Oscar Straus's The Chocolate Soldier, which he toured in England. He was said to be the youngest operatic conductor in England.
